System Reset Interventions

Meaning

System Reset Interventions are clinical protocols designed to interrupt and reverse chronic, maladaptive physiological patterns, such as insulin resistance, HPA axis dysfunction, or chronic inflammatory states, by imposing a temporary, controlled physiological stressor or withdrawal. These interventions aim to break the negative feedback loops that perpetuate systemic dysfunction, allowing the body’s homeostatic mechanisms to re-establish a healthier baseline. They are often used as a powerful catalyst at the start of a comprehensive health optimization plan to enhance subsequent therapeutic responsiveness.
